The doctor shot and killed Tuesday at the El Paso Veterans Affairs Health Care System clinic was described as a great psychologist who was committed to helping veterans. Timothy Fjordbak, 63, left a successful private psychology practice after the terrorist attacks in New York City, Washington,...
